Baldwin on the ballot in Massachusetts

Friday, August 29th, 2008

CPOMA member, Rich Selfridge announced that Chuck Baldwin has made it on the ballot in Massachusetts.

The last time a CP Presidential candidate was on the ballot there was back in 1992.

In other news, the Constitution Party got on the ballot in Louisiana recently, and is expected to get on in other southern states.

Constitution Party fights to get on Pennsylvania ballot

Thursday, August 28th, 2008

Ballot Access News reports that the Constitution Party of Pennsylvania has submitted another 8,000 signatures “to supplement the 22,000 they submitted on the legal deadline, August 1. Not surprisingly, the Pennsylvania Elections Department rejected the additional signatures. The requirement is 24,666 signatures.”

Court Rules: Keyes On, Baldwin Off California Ballot

Tuesday, August 26th, 2008

From Ballot Access News:

On August 26, Superior Court Judge Michael Kenny ruled in favor of the Alan Keyes faction of the American Independent Party. The case is called King v Bowen, 34-2008-80000016.
